Though long closed for "environmental study," the Surprise Canyon OHV trail — which prior to a flood in 1984 could be traversed in a Honda Civic — was for a dozen years one of the most difficult 4x4 trails in the country. We spent a day hiking the canyon to the ghost town of Panamint City. View Related Article
